? Cachar som används i datorer är snabba pooler av minne som är utformade för att påskynda överföringen av data mellan snabba och långsammare enheter . Bortsett från att användas för att buffra data kan cachar besitter logik programvara stöd , så att de kan börja bearbeta rutiner i förväg . Funktioner av Cache
cacher
fungera som skriver cachar när de är inblandade i överföringen av data från en snabbare enhet till en långsammare enhet . Det gör att du skickar informationen och sedan göra en ny uppgift, medan den översätter datan . Läs cache är också konstruerade för att arbeta mellan snabbare och långsammare enheter och har stöd logik för att i förväg hämta det du behöver nästa . På detta sätt , det långsamt pre - läser den information du kan tänkas behöva , så att när du vill läsa in den , kommer den att ladda snabbare . Buffertminne är utformad för att lagra din senaste tillgängliga informationen så att om du vill komma åt den igen , kan du göra det snabbt . Addera L1 Cache
L1 cache , vilket står för nivå 1 -cache , är en typ av liten och snabbt minne som är inbyggd i den centrala behandlingsenheten . Ofta kallas intern cache eller primär cache , används den för att komma åt viktiga och ofta använda data. L1 cache är den snabbaste och dyraste typen av cache som är inbyggd i datorn .
L2 Cache
L2 , eller nivå 2 , är cache används att lagra nyligen visats information. Även känd som sekundär cache , är det avsett att minska den tid som behövs för att komma åt data i de fall där data redan nås tidigare . L2-cache kan också minska dataåtkomst tid genom att buffra de data som processorn är på väg att begära från minnet, samt instruktioner program . L2 -cache är sekundärt till CPU och är långsammare än L1-cache , trots att de ofta är mycket större . Dessutom är uppgifter som begärs från L2-cache kopieras till L1 cache . Önskade data tas bort från L2-cache om det är en exklusiv cache , och stannar där om det är ett inkluderande cache . L2-cache är oftast enat , vilket betyder att det används för att lagra både programdata och instruktioner . Addera L3 Cache
L3 , eller nivå 3 , är cache en minnescachen som är inbyggd i moderkortet . Det används för att mata L2-cache , och är vanligtvis snabbare än systemets främsta minne , men fortfarande långsammare än L2-cache .